We are currently seeking experienced and passionate
Fundraising Managers
to join some of Australia's most respected charities, healthcare organisations and purpose-led not-for-profits.
These are fantastic permanent opportunities for fundraising professionals looking to take the next step in their career, lead impactful fundraising programs and make a genuine difference through their work.
Salaries range from
$100,000 - $140,000 + super
depending on experience and level of responsibility.

Key Responsibilities
Developing and delivering fundraising strategies and campaigns.
Managing and growing donor portfolios and supporter relationships.
Driving fundraising income, acquisition, retention and engagement.
Developing compelling appeals, campaigns and donor communications.
Building strong relationships with major donors, partners and key stakeholders.
Managing fundraising budgets, reporting and performance against targets.
Working collaboratively across fundraising, marketing, communications and programs teams.
Identifying new opportunities to grow income and strengthen supporter engagement.
Leading and mentoring fundraising teams where required.
